the big bang theory of fiction

The "Muppet Morsels" glosses on my DVDs of The Muppet Show are sometimes only loosely related to the episode, so it's hard to remember where this one came from.

I paraphrase: "every skit ends with either an explosion or a digestion."

I.e., something blows up, or somebody gets eaten.

This could be generally applicable to all fiction.

Boom! Nom nom nom.

Books would be a lot more fun if it was literal.

Elizabeth and Darcy marry--and a giant sheep eats Lady Catherine De Burgh!

Moby Dick explodes!

David Copperfield turns into a zombie and eats everyone!
